Product reviews:
Pokemon teddy bear 37 pokemon teddy bear pokemon
pokemon teddy bear pokemon
Snorlax Poké Plush - 19 1/4 In pokemon teddy bear pokemon
pokemon teddy bear pokemon
Marsh
2025-12-14 iphone 11 Pro
Pokémon Go December events bring pokemon teddy bear pokemon
pokemon teddy bear pokemon